“Blessed be the God and Father of our Lord Jesus Christ, which according to His abundant mercy hath begotten us again unto a lively hope by the resurrection of Jesus Christ from the dead.” I Peter 1:3
How do we bless God? We always think and ask God to bless us and usually do not have any idea how we can bless the sovereign, holy, and righteous God of the entire universe. It is almost unfathomable to even think that there is any thing that we can do, as sinful and small as we are compared to Almighty God, that would be considered a blessing to Him. However, there is something that we can do: we can attribute to Him the characteristics that belong to Him only–sovereignty, goodness, mercy, kindness, love, longsuffering, and faithfulness. We can acknowledge His excellency, majesty, royalty, divinity, supremacy, omniscience, omnipresence, and omnipotence.
He is the God and Father of our Lord Jesus Christ whom He sent in human form to become the sacrifice that would redeem us back to Him. He did this because of His mercy and love for His creation. If God had not sent Jesus to pay the penalty for our sin, then we would be forever lost without a hope in the world. We could never earn the favor of God, and therefore, we would be destined to eternal punishment and God’s wrath.
But praise be to God that He did send His son to die for us, and Jesus’ resurrection proves that His sacrifice fully satisfied God’s penalty for sin. His resurrection also proves that we who have repented of our sins and placed our faith in Christ will one day be resurrected to live with Him forever. This is our lively hope–a hope that lives and breathes and keeps us going day after day.
